Are All Spigots The Same Size. 1/2 inch and 3/4 inch. What size is a standard outdoor water spigot? A spigot, in plumbing terminology, refers to a protruding nozzle or pipe fitting used to control the flow of liquids. Outdoor spigots are typically available in two sizes: These sizes refer to the pipe diameter. This is the size of the valve and pipe leading to the spigot but it does not really change the look of the spigot in any way. An outdoor faucet can either be ½ inch or ¾ inch. The two sizes are also the common widths of water pipes. Some decorative faucets, or ones intended for limited use, will be faucets without hose threading.
